Hey Marisol — handing off the Quillpress markdown pipeline before my leave. Sanitizer runs after the custom block parser, not before, so flag that in your review. Rendering workers pull configs from the sealed Driftlock store. If you need to rotate the store during audit, you'll need the recovery phrase. Dropping it below so you're not blocked.

unlock words, yawig-kagef: gordor-holvan-ulaael-pramir-ulaiel-tamdor

Subject: Quickstore 4.2 — bloom filter now fronts the KV layer

Plugin authors: starting with this release, Quickstore places a bloom filter ahead of the key-value store. Negative lookups return faster; false positives fall through safely. No API changes are required on your side. Verify your plugin against the staging build referenced below.

session token of fahif-tadup = htk3_9c7

# Cold Storage Archival — notes for the weekly eng sync (Team Permafrost)
# This config governs the nightly sweep that moves buckets untouched for 180+
# days from the Tarnwell hot tier into Glacierpoint cold storage. Please review
# ARCHIVE_BATCH_SIZE carefully before changing it; batches over 500 objects
# have caused manifest timeouts twice this quarter. Restores must go through
# the ops queue, never directly. The sweep job authenticates to the
# Glacierpoint API with the key declared on the next line.

secret setting of kagug-tajep: COURIER_KEY8=e81a8675